Abstract :
Different control charts are developed for monitoring various types of quality characteristics in the area of Statistical Process Monitoring (SPM). Moreover, new techniques are proposed to improve the performances of the suggested control charts. One of the popular techniques for this purpose is run rules. These rules increase the sensitivity of control charts in detecting different shift sizes, especially small and medium shifts. In this paper, a content analysis (based on 100 papers in this area from 1955 to 2020) is conducted to (i) classify the articles that employed run rules in SPM, (ii) recognize the research gaps and (iii) provide guidance to motivate future research in this area.
